memcached-1.5.6-lp151.4.3.1<>,Lt^lj/=„m5]KꟌgҐkbTUO4j'EhYX>c;*Yڅ9g7SȤ(HŒVT*aQ %@X,pt3Ќ=-]m>7}h,G8!w~A GL7շ^0\Z2b}>׹`gv7\}C-వEћ`!myB_DŽ9|(W'zp0Sf8hЕ0EZ&D 5Grʍu_KqKX>I2?2 d   [  6<CAZa       @       Hl !<!!(8 9L :% =,>,!?,)@,1F,9G,L H,| I, X,Y,\, ]- ^-b.=c.d/ye/~f/l/u/ v/w1 x1@ y1pz11112Cmemcached1.5.6lp151.4.3.1A high-performance, distributed memory object caching systemMemcached is a high-performance, distributed memory object caching system, generic in nature, but intended for use in speeding up dynamic web applications by alleviating database load. Danga Interactive developed memcached to enhance the speed of LiveJournal.com, a site which was already doing 20 million+ dynamic page views per day for 1 million users with a bunch of webservers and a bunch of database servers. memcached dropped the database load to almost nothing, yielding faster page load times for users, better resource utilization, and faster access to the databases on a memcache miss.^ljlamb03"openSUSE Leap 15.1openSUSEBSD-3-Clausehttp://bugs.opensuse.orgProductivity/Networking/Otherhttp://memcached.org/linuxx86_64/usr/sbin/groupadd -r memcached >/dev/null 2>&1 || : /usr/sbin/useradd -g memcached -s /bin/false -r -c "user for memcached" -d /var/lib/memcached memcached >/dev/null 2>&1 || : test -n "$FIRST_ARG" || FIRST_ARG="$1" # disable migration if initial install under systemd [ -d /var/lib/systemd/migrated ] || mkdir -p /var/lib/systemd/migrated || : if [ "$FIRST_ARG" -eq 1 ]; then for service in memcached.service ; do sysv_service="${service%.*}" touch "/var/lib/systemd/migrated/$sysv_service" || : done else for service in memcached.service ; do # The tag file might have been left by a preceding # update (see 1059627) rm -f "/run/rpm-memcached-update-$service-new-in-upgrade" if [ ! -e "/usr/lib/systemd/system/$service" ]; then touch "/run/rpm-memcached-update-$service-new-in-upgrade" fi done for service in memcached.service ; do sysv_service="${service%.*}" if [ -e /var/lib/systemd/migrated/$sysv_service ]; then continue fi if [ ! -x /usr/sbin/systemd-sysv-convert ]; then continue fi /usr/sbin/systemd-sysv-convert --save $sysv_service || : done fi test -n "$FIRST_ARG" || FIRST_ARG="$1" [ -d /var/lib/systemd/migrated ] || mkdir -p /var/lib/systemd/migrated || : if [ "$YAST_IS_RUNNING" != "instsys" -a -x /usr/bin/systemctl ]; then /usr/bin/systemctl daemon-reload || : fi if [ "$FIRST_ARG" -eq 1 ]; then if [ -x /usr/bin/systemctl ]; then /usr/bin/systemctl preset memcached.service || : fi elif [ "$FIRST_ARG" -gt 1 ]; then for service in memcached.service ; do if [ ! -e "/run/rpm-memcached-update-$service-new-in-upgrade" ]; then continue fi rm -f "/run/rpm-memcached-update-$service-new-in-upgrade" if [ ! -x /usr/bin/systemctl ]; then continue fi /usr/bin/systemctl preset "$service" || : done for service in memcached.service ; do sysv_service=${service%.*} if [ -e /var/lib/systemd/migrated/$sysv_service ]; then continue fi if [ ! -x /usr/sbin/systemd-sysv-convert ]; then continue fi /usr/sbin/systemd-sysv-convert --apply $sysv_service || : touch /var/lib/systemd/migrated/$sysv_service || : done fi PNAME=memcached SUBPNAME= SYSC_TEMPLATE=/usr/share/fillup-templates/sysconfig.$PNAME$SUBPNAME # If template not in new /usr/share/fillup-templates, fallback to old TEMPLATE_DIR if [ ! -f $SYSC_TEMPLATE ] ; then TEMPLATE_DIR=/var/adm/fillup-templates SYSC_TEMPLATE=$TEMPLATE_DIR/sysconfig.$PNAME$SUBPNAME fi SD_NAME="" if [ -x /bin/fillup ] ; then if [ -f $SYSC_TEMPLATE ] ; then echo "Updating /etc/sysconfig/$SD_NAME$PNAME ..." mkdir -p /etc/sysconfig/$SD_NAME touch /etc/sysconfig/$SD_NAME$PNAME /bin/fillup -q /etc/sysconfig/$SD_NAME$PNAME $SYSC_TEMPLATE fi else echo "ERROR: fillup not found. This should not happen. Please compare" echo "/etc/sysconfig/$PNAME and $TEMPLATE_DIR/sysconfig.$PNAME and" echo "update by hand." fi test -n "$FIRST_ARG" || FIRST_ARG="$1" if [ "$FIRST_ARG" -eq 0 -a -x /usr/bin/systemctl ]; then # Package removal, not upgrade /usr/bin/systemctl --no-reload disable memcached.service || : ( test "$YAST_IS_RUNNING" = instsys && exit 0 test -f /etc/sysconfig/services -a \ -z "$DISABLE_STOP_ON_REMOVAL" && . /etc/sysconfig/services test "$DISABLE_STOP_ON_REMOVAL" = yes -o \ "$DISABLE_STOP_ON_REMOVAL" = 1 && exit 0 /usr/bin/systemctl stop memcached.service ) || : fi test -n "$FIRST_ARG" || FIRST_ARG="$1" if [ "$FIRST_ARG" -ge 1 ]; then # Package upgrade, not uninstall if [ -x /usr/bin/systemctl ]; then /usr/bin/systemctl daemon-reload || : ( test "$YAST_IS_RUNNING" = instsys && exit 0 test -f /etc/sysconfig/services -a \ -z "$DISABLE_RESTART_ON_UPDATE" && . /etc/sysconfig/services test "$DISABLE_RESTART_ON_UPDATE" = yes -o \ "$DISABLE_RESTART_ON_UPDATE" = 1 && exit 0 /usr/bin/systemctl try-restart memcached.service ) || : fi else # package uninstall for service in memcached.service ; do sysv_service="${service%.*}" rm -f "/var/lib/systemd/migrated/$sysv_service" || : done if [ -x /usr/bin/systemctl ]; then /usr/bin/systemctl daemon-reload || : fi fipJEL A큤A^Lj5^Lj5^Lj5^Lj5^ljR0J*YXWFq^Lj5^Lj5^Lj55e7fb00523cb37858dd1367643d6cf0fe0b0caf3b96402139c582214ba0fbbfc2d11d7bd15fd2aea4f8e34e3ccda38339df6943245af6e167c633d26b70d3a9ce05f83bb8f5a01e1e2a776364c9e2dda698171629bdec3710e6b934de994cfd07432b777139963f1f271b9422a19613d35a07dcb4b6b3d56f3cf81921668c96abc887c4ad8051fe690ace9528fe37a2e0bb362e6d963331d82e845ca9b585a0cff8fd6b514e35693c96321ffafe08684f3320be86c22657c14730c3462182fe4408d84698b04bb00cdc35bfc88f530c7049d0e4024d6b0fc116d36a274c1191f10fbe2fab607c664e37448cda6ec46b81838fc27b234c7043d0d9cbd807555401ca704b0e7e0c606dfc373d655a2d4ef0316babbc13b2b5dac25239ede9960a8serviceroot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ootmemcached-1.5.6-lp151.4.3.1.src.rpmmemcachedmemcached(x86-64) @@@@@@@@@@@@@@@    /bin/sh/bin/sh/bin/sh/bin/sh/usr/bin/perl/usr/sbin/groupadd/usr/sbin/useraddcoreutilsdiffutilsfillupgreplibc.so.6()(64bit)libc.so.6(GLIBC_2.10)(64bit)libc.so.6(GLIBC_2.14)(64bit)libc.so.6(GLIBC_2.16)(64bit)libc.so.6(GLIBC_2.17)(64bit)libc.so.6(GLIBC_2.2.5)(64bit)libc.so.6(GLIBC_2.3)(64bit)libc.so.6(GLIBC_2.3.4)(64bit)libc.so.6(GLIBC_2.4)(64bit)libevent-2.1.so.6()(64bit)libpthread.so.0()(64bit)libpthread.so.0(GLIBC_2.2.5)(64bit)libpthread.so.0(GLIBC_2.3.2)(64bit)libsasl2.so.3()(64bit)rpmlib(CompressedFileNames)rpmlib(FileDigests)rpmlib(PayloadFilesHavePrefix)rpmlib(PayloadIsXz)systemdsystemdsystemdsystemd3.0.4-14.6.0-14.0-15.2-1memcached-unstable4.14.1]nU\ZZw@Z@YKXӸX lV]U~@TT_W@pgajdos@suse.compgajdos@suse.comsflees@suse.dedmueller@suse.comrbrown@suse.comtbechtold@suse.commchandras@suse.demrueckert@suse.dep.drouand@gmail.commrueckert@suse.dempluskal@suse.comLed - security update - run the testsuite - added patches CVE-2019-15026 [bsc#1149110] + memcached-CVE-2019-15026.patch new version of the test (from 1.5.17) + memcached-lru-maintainer.t.patch- security update - added patches CVE-2019-11596 [bsc#1133817] + memcached-CVE-2019-11596.patch- Home directory shouldn't be world readable bsc#1077718 - Mention that this stream isn't affected by bsc#1085209, CVE-2018-1000127 to make the checker bots happy.- update to 1.5.6 (bsc#1083903, CVE-2018-1000115): * This update disables UDP by default to reduce DDoS amplification attacks * see https://github.com/memcached/memcached/wiki/ReleaseNotes156 * see https://github.com/memcached/memcached/wiki/ReleaseNotes155 * see https://github.com/memcached/memcached/wiki/ReleaseNotes154 * see https://github.com/memcached/memcached/wiki/ReleaseNotes153 * see https://github.com/memcached/memcached/wiki/ReleaseNotes152 * see https://github.com/memcached/memcached/wiki/ReleaseNotes151 * see https://github.com/memcached/memcached/wiki/ReleaseNotes150- Replace references to /var/adm/fillup-templates with new %_fillupdir macro (boo#1069468)- update to 1.4.39: https://github.com/memcached/memcached/wiki/ReleaseNotes1439 (bsc#1056865) (CVE-2017-9951) https://github.com/memcached/memcached/wiki/ReleaseNotes1438 https://github.com/memcached/memcached/wiki/ReleaseNotes1437 https://github.com/memcached/memcached/wiki/ReleaseNotes1436 https://github.com/memcached/memcached/wiki/ReleaseNotes1435 https://github.com/memcached/memcached/wiki/ReleaseNotes1434- Use the MEMCACHED_USER variable from the /etc/sysconfig/memcached file to determine the user for the memcached process instead of hardcoding it in the service file.- update to 1.4.33 https://github.com/memcached/memcached/wiki/ReleaseNotes1433 https://github.com/memcached/memcached/wiki/ReleaseNotes1432 https://github.com/memcached/memcached/wiki/ReleaseNotes1431 https://github.com/memcached/memcached/wiki/ReleaseNotes1430 https://github.com/memcached/memcached/wiki/ReleaseNotes1429 https://github.com/memcached/memcached/wiki/ReleaseNotes1428 https://github.com/memcached/memcached/wiki/ReleaseNotes1427 https://github.com/memcached/memcached/wiki/ReleaseNotes1426 (bsc #1007871) (CVE-2016-8704) (bsc #1007870) (CVE-2016-8705) (bsc #1007869) (CVE-2016-8706) - refreshed patches to apply cleanly again: memcached-1.4.5.dif memcached-autofoo.patch memcached-use-endian_h.patch- Update to version 1.4.25: * Please read the news at https://github.com/memcached/memcached/wiki/ReleaseNotes1425 - Update memcached-autofoo.patch- fix comment in the sysconfig file- Cleanup spec file * using spec-cleaner * remove unnecessary %defines - Create new package (devel) - Install either init script or unit file - Refresh dependencies - Update to 1.4.22 * gatkq: return key in response * Handle SIGTERM the same as SIGINT * Fix off-by-one causing segfault in lru_crawler * Fix potential corruption for incr/decr of 0b items * Fix issue #369 - uninitialized stats_lock * issue#370 : slab re-balance is not thread-safe in function do_item_get * Fix potential corruption in hash table expansion * use item lock instead of global lock when hash expanding * fix hang when lru crawler started from commandline * rename thread_init to avoid runtime failure on AIX * Support -V (version option) - Changes for 1.4.21 * makefile cleanups * Avoid OOM errors when locked items stuck in tail- fix bashisms in pre script/bin/sh/bin/sh/bin/sh/bin/shlamb03 1590135041 1.5.6-lp151.4.3.11.5.6-lp151.4.3.1memcached.servicememcachedmemcached-toolrcmemcachedmemcachedAUTHORSCOPYINGChangeLogNEWSsysconfig.memcachedmemcached.1.gzmemcached/usr/lib/systemd/system//usr/sbin//usr/share/doc/packages//usr/share/doc/packages/memcached//usr/share/fillup-templates//usr/share/man/man1//var/lib/-fmessage-length=0 -grecord-gcc-switches -O2 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ector-strong -funwind-tables -fasynchronous-unwind-tables -fstack-clash-protection -gobs://build.opensuse.org/openSUSE:Maintenance:12682/openSUSE_Leap_15.1_Update/4c9c26c95110f46d7bb2d68fb7609189-memcached.openSUSE_Leap_15.1_Updatedrpmxz5x86_64-suse-linuxASCII textELF 64-bit LSB shared object, x86-64, version 1 (SYSV), dynamically linked, interpreter /lib64/l, BuildID[sha1]=24ab897b093887540aaaf0e55191104f8995cabe, for GNU/Linux 3.2.0, strippedPerl script text executabledirectorytroff or preprocessor input, ASCII text (gzip compressed data, max compression, from Unix)RRRR RR RRRRRRRR RLe!}d`Lutf-8a5a47a84f23a8dc925f1eb55140b18839c6ab35630a905d3c7e44e430a6530fe?p7zXZ !t/*)_]"k%rfȖO˫H`Ӥ`aoRQ z`@=tKC d"@9 SDLOObed7>Wr# L*J[c;}*%88+1}Sa[, z1!(܊LCa63篭AT( k2X<\o>735-x5q\j " e0&A3pvL<`?jGDhjv}vݒĭ+ S:Пc>0(|_]-c0*Ž3J29x%Kl{@P yvF)CWBcR O@h,T`|6 <}BJ"OLħļͽTpWܰEWN?=Ndy~~CD*a*9vXAOɡ ghK ropmwbN20C@(GarXu '({ O5e)BX6cZ)dCp%K7$7P2Ip%Xzbfp$e.U94ʹ8ꡦ}E8\E\/#5ֹ=,RDCcGcX+6db#0j--%j>~AW%/Dr{(QO7el%31 r C(@l !o·Rg{ 9CSH>9ǜm,lf {A(T$?HITdq j7G^0o{iQEwLJC+Yzߦ>,cSޠn "\~ D0sg( ԵW˂I%P=ѽ _dC%(2bm+ӏkqެ\ItXmv~b;_)G 'RY)̲<?i&%޲g 0"ۆd4ƌIևQl΄6IpHՐK_I![$nS&K9DW wCcG AV&YhGdmb]qɪz4oށ <ЛnԼmO śbBxSw (HxTˍNwƭZ7_2U5jTI פĵ2f(alq ,Mb/.X&!"Vr@Nq; v"EJ׫dד&uN< 9,b5KYR*$c?ׇ o Oڨ;aWTb!QwΊS4P 5ndM(r4ջؚ EIx<.;S]Ma{m{\#\}QYEQk5hH8lJS o k*?rL*棚nؘ"wiZ㨝ɋ]a_ꆮ0Ʊcnp7Z^f"h{3-rSUxkr3y%4gĉ$ֳYFE21y^Ǣ`WM囔mH8>Xo"KE#Sد0bIvI2jLwĸ_{lA>}=۪vteewݯҡ'j9yo;=ThNf8Z./[N%b+(\޹yj2 TrPix9bu%P;tr['~]@oϺ%. 1f2acm~Ld0A)T#a+?"4 4?0推ѥU{ t&$Ʊöݨh=pm3:0JM#9r^Ƙ{ *2$|BQLҴdŨTuz dJ?螖E3Sh9'ÑYK)N*DžSaIFsMetSu)w.}7:1üueM`IEfEH1Wl&C<TlgD >w"| EJ5E-iL]ʿñe#Mn b$$* LJbVSͽQخ59@y"y!b!]+˺1=H-Q+PG:"Kb }fZK~-v:c5'>+3M9LJY:`&_H(W%Iᄳ?S /j J gБ0:B%Nqv:\ '{8p a[/ӽג:e8. %-~j^(4nT{ܼ} 9neȚ (%zMj"3YП4y4Yr:ϋ 6y3nͲk>-*[6Y FDoP>#*,jZD o[J "ZieXNwW, 0za.8mI fyx(ff%d9BҊOhJaxLY'!ؖ(x Ѭ$? )/4€?'kVS /9uGaZ_{r¾I㓓{xV9>㨃04os1G$:Rz|Cy_In:<3?Ɣ^X2h˲Ԯ'CǎdnB/Qy|@ Dk$}Ҕ9(ɜ-GӫWIEɛdtoE:M4|X)8t6N;1_Ѻ\x u(hH 6U,é_X&T>h*pW?8#YG{gL.4@FT[MD6FPWO'{H0so+UC0GǺd(3 *BW$HMl'^[ {-u HUbv^~J9X݅.&j=cF@$z`ABgB*s"+nx pqJE4gx-h2@iD=]h>gqDV>3 LHSοU6nJ~&] iLv+sʖ jc^Nx&CLG R1 G=+$ɧw.$6Syz$)HH'sT3ؗא^`NcXwD97&?uMX]PƸvw#PS " q}[N( ʣ  9}`+T(է YZ